What are GPhC inspection reports?
The General Pharmaceutical Council (GPhC) inspects registered pharmacies against five standards. Reports show whether the pharmacy met the standards, with improvement or enforcement action where needed. Premises ID is the same as the pharmacy's GPhC registration number.

Pharmacy context
This community pharmacy is located in a pedestrianised square in Kempston, Bedford. It dispenses NHS and private prescriptions, and it sells medicines over the counter. The pharmacy provides NHS services such as Pharmacy First and seasonal Covid vaccinations. It also provides some private services under patient group directions (PGDs) such as a travel vaccination service. The pharmacy supplies multi-compartment compliance packs to some people, and it offers a delivery service for people who cannot get to the pharmacy. This was a desktop reinspection following an inspection in March 2025 where the pharmacy did not meet Standard 4.2. This reinspection focused on the Standard which had previously not been met. Since the inspection, the pharmacy has implemented and signed updated patient group directions (PGDs) for its private services to ensure it is providing these services safely.

Understanding IMD
The Index of Multiple Deprivation (IMD) measures relative deprivation across England. It ranks all 33,755 LSOAs (England, 2021 boundaries) from most deprived (rank 1) to least deprived (rank 33,755).
